Okay wait... $1 an audio minute? I can transcribe perfectly 20 audio minutes in one hour. And I literally have no experience. Wouldn't that mean I'd be making $20 an hour ?!?!?
@@Drewski777 Rev charges $1/min to customers, but only pays their workers about 54 cents per minute, or maybe less now. For a fast worker, it takes about 1 hour to transcribe/caption ten minutes of audio, IF it's good audio quality. So that's about $5.40 per hour IF you're working very quickly and IF the audio quality is very good. Most of the jobs have terrible audio quality. Some jobs pay more than 54 cents per minute, but those tend to be atrocious in quality. Then the graders will go through your work with a fine-tooth comb and criticize you for totally inconsequential stuff. I've been failed on projects for typing lowercase "a" instead of capital "A" as in "A plus B equals C", and literally a thousand other minor insignificant details that no human could be expected to get right. They have no tolerance for errors or typos. IF you managed you survive for a few months and get to Revver+, you would get first pick of jobs in the queue, which means higher audio quality, easier jobs, but lower pay. Jobs that are less than a minute still pay a full minute. So a 10 second file still pays 54 cents. There are also occasionally easy videos with no dialogue, only music or atmospherics, or kids' videos like the alphabet song (ABCDE...). IF you can snatch those up first, you might make $20/hr, but they got very fast, are few and far between, and rarely last for more than 15 minutes.
